I love a poached egg on a white cheddar rice cake. It's just a little over a hundred calories but has lots of protein. If I need a bigger snack I'll add a slice of chicken or turkey deli meat.0

Post dinner time snacks I like: babybel cheese (70 cal), low sodium almonds (170 cal, 1 gr sat fat, 6g protein, 3g fiber), laughing cow swiss wedge (50 cal) on bagel crisps (120 cal) or celery stalk, Snyder pretzel rods (120 cal), apple or banana0
